Staff Relations Manager

What you will do

Lets do this. Lets change the this vital role you will be responsible for conducting HR investigations and providing expert employee relations (ER) guidance and support to managers and staff across Amgens Latin America (LATAM) region United States and Puerto Rico.

Staff Relations is a specialized Human Resources function that partners closely with regional HR Leaders Business Managers Compliance Legal other HR Centers of Excellence and team members to protect Amgen values investigate potential violations of HR policies provide practical advice and guidance on coaching staff and managers and advise on performance and behaviors management discipline involuntary terminations and workplace accommodations.

  • Provide practical and legally appropriate staff relations guidance on performance management disciplinary action and workplace conflict to HR partners and business leaders in LATAM Puerto Rico and the United States. Participate in termination discussions and corrective actions with staff and leaders as needed.
  • Conduct and document thorough impartial and timely HR investigations maintaining confidentiality and objectivity. Determine findings of fact and violations of policy and prepare clear concise investigation summaries and supporting documentation to support these findings.
  • Partner with the Occupational Heath staff and managers to analyze and respond to leaves of absence return to work following them and reasonable accommodation requests.
  • Partner with local and regional HR Business Partners and Staff Relations team members in the United States and Puerto Rico to ensure culturally nuanced and compliant ER practices.
  • Track and update cases in the companys case management system.
  • Assist the Regional Staff Relations Lead in implementing process improvements training and ER best practices.
  • Collaborate with Compliance Legal and Learning & Development teams to deliver training on HR policies investigations and respectful workplace behaviors.

What we expect of you

We are all different yet we all use our unique contributions to serve patients. The Staff Relations Manager we seek is a professional with these qualifications:

Basic Qualifications:

Doctorate degree

Or

Masters degree and 2 years of Staff Relations experience

Or

Bachelors degree and 4 years of Staff Relations experience

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Strong Human Resources background with 4 years of experience in Employee Relations
  • Knowledge of employment laws and Employee Relations practices in LATAM and the U.S.
  • Experience conducting internal HR investigations
  • Experience advising on performance management discipline and involuntary terminations of employment
  • Advanced proficiency in English and Spanish with excellent written and oral communication skills
  • Ability to learn and fairly apply company policy investigation procedures and regulatory guidelines within scope of duties
  • Experience working across different countries and cultures with a commitment to educating oneself on cultural norms and varying laws
  • Strong judgment discretion and professionalism in handling complex and confidential matters.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office tools Teams/WebEx Workday and case management systems such as EthicsPoint.
